I have an unlimited data plan on my phone that I use as a personal hotspot and share with laptop/iPad etc., typically to watch films, or game etc. For some reason these are going into low-data mode when connecting, which is obviously useless. Why might that be? And how do I actually get unlimited data, or even an increase? Presumably there is some limit (to avoid users doing something ridiculous involving TBs per day)?

There is like a 600GB limit on an unlimited data. This won't stop you using data but they slow your speed down.
Unlimited is not truly unlimited.
Also there is a device limit on hotspotting which I believe is 12
If you constantly break these policies they will deem you an business holder and move you to an equivalent business deal which will obviously cost more
